The QC Headphones are a great option in the company’s broader lineup of headphones and earbuds, which also includes the pricier QC Ultra Headphones, QC Ultra Earbuds, and entry-level QC Earbuds. The standard QC Headphones preserve the lightweight design of the last-gen QuietComfort 45 and include Bose’s terrific noise cancellation, so you can block out your snoring seat neighbor on the plane.

The QC Headphones allow you to quickly toggle between blocking out the outside world and letting ambient noise in, which is a nice feature when you need to hear a boarding call. Additionally, they support multipoint connectivity, allowing them to be paired with two devices simultaneously. They also offer up to 24 hours of battery life, so you’ll be able to get through a long travel day when an outlet isn’t nearby. And when you do make it to your destination, they fold up neatly, making it easier to store them in your bag.
